Neymeiyer County Estates sits on the western edge of 24th Avenue & Linden Drive Area, where the landscape opens up into spacious, tree-lined lots that feel removed from the everyday rush. From here, downtown Grand Rapids is a seventeen-minute drive south, and the Lake Michigan shore at Grand Haven stretches about thirty-three minutes west—close enough for a Saturday morning, far enough to preserve the quieter character of the land itself. Cole Park sits less than a mile away, one of two parks within easy reach, offering trails and green space without the sense of being hemmed in by development.

Frequently asked about Neymeiyer County Estates
- What do homes cost in Neymeiyer County Estates?
- The median home value in Neymeiyer County Estates is about $1,176,350. Individual prices vary by street, size, and condition.
- How active is the Neymeiyer County Estates housing market?
- there is 1 home for sale in Neymeiyer County Estates right now. Listings refresh throughout the day from the MichRIC MLS.
- What schools serve Neymeiyer County Estates?
- Neymeiyer County Estates is served by Kenowa Hills Public Schools. Its highest-rated assigned school is Kenowa Hills Central Elementary School (3/10).
- Is Neymeiyer County Estates walkable?
- Neymeiyer County Estates scores 2.6/10 for walkability — a measure of walking, biking, and driving access to groceries, dining, parks, schools, and transit.
